Bride: Allannah Jenkins
Groom: Nigel Smith
Wedding date: Saturday, October 12, 2016
The meeting: We met on my back veranda for the first time when I came home from work.. I was expecting another tradesman I had spoken to arrange for some work I needing done at my house.
Nigel had been sent instead and was apologetic that I wasn't aware that he had been sent instead to do the work ... I was delighted to see such a tall dark and handsome man. We both felt a strong connection from that moment.
The proposal: Nigel proposed at our favorite restaurant, The Woodhouse, on August 22, 2015 by getting down on bended knee.
The wedding day: We were married at the Bendigo Pottery with Bernie Fitt as Nigel’s best man and Judy-Ann Cantwell as my matron of honour. My eight gorgeous grandchildren were all in the wedding party. I set up the wedding the morning of the wedding with the help of my sisters and created the style of classic vintage spring with the colour yellow a feature. Miranda from Eternal Vase was fabulous working side by side with me to create the stunning look.
The dress: I purchased my dress from Bendigo Bridal Collections. It fitted the classical vintage theme and it was a soft lace that fitted beautifully and was incredibly comfortable to wear.
The cake: Our amazing cake was created by Nigel’s mother whom had driven it down from Swan Hill the day before the wedding. She had made the entire cake flowers and all!
Photography: Ildiko Gagyor – was such fun!
Honeymoon destination: Our honeymoon included stays at Hamilton Island and Daydream Island.
